here are four simple ways to stay
motivated and keep going number one find
a way to enjoy learning number two see
your progress number three have
something to lose number four do it
regardless of how you feel
let’s start with the first one number
one find a way to enjoy learning if you
want to reach a goal or learn a language
you need to ask yourself some questions
how are you going to do it is it through
a your desire to reach this goal or be
the actual learning process you can want
and think and dream about the goal all
you want but it’s the process the
learning not the wanting that actually
gets you there so you have to enjoy the
process how well what interests you
what’s your passion are you into sports
TV shows music
watching YouTube traveling whatever it
is take your interests and base your
language learning on that take lessons
based on the topics you love you already
have an emotional connection to your
interests right this makes learning much
more enjoyable and keeps you motivated

right next up number two senior progress
this is the next best way to stay
motivated imagine going to the gym for a
few weeks and finally starting to see
some muscle in the mirror seeing results
is pretty motivating it feels good to
see progress it’s fun so how do you
apply that to language learning you
can’t really see language muscles but
there are a few things you can do first

number three have something to lose this
is a little unusual but it works a great
way to motivate yourself is to try not
to lose something in psychology it’s
called loss aversion studies show we
feel more upset about losing ten dollars
than we feel happy about finding ten
dollars now how do you apply this to
language use loss aversion as motivation

four do it regardless of how you feel
this tactic might help you make the most
language-learning progress of all in
reality you’ll feel tired some days some
days your mind will be elsewhere and you
won’t want to learn and some days life
will happen things will pop up school
work tests birthdays you might get sick
but do it anyway
